international parcel shipping has long been constrained by manual paperwork, siloed systems, and limited visibility. Today, a wave of technologies is redefining every stage—from booking and tracking to delivery—driving efficiency, reducing costs, and elevating customer experience.
- Digital Documentation and Paperless Trade
Electronic Data Interchange (EDI) and paperless trade platforms have replaced paper customs forms with digital filings. Automated submission of customs declarations and commercial invoices accelerates clearance, cuts processing errors, and allows carriers and authorities to exchange data instantly. - API Integration and Automated Workflows
Modern shipping management systems connect via APIs to multiple carriers, pulling real-time rate quotes, scheduling pickups, and generating labels in bulk. Automated workflows trigger documentation, billing, and notifications—freeing teams from repetitive tasks and enabling rapid scaling of international parcel shipping operations. - AI-Driven Route Optimization
Machine learning models analyze historical transit times, weather, and copyright performance to recommend the fastest or most cost-effective routes. Predictive analytics also forecast demand spikes—allowing shippers to lock in capacity and avoid last-minute surcharges. - IoT Sensors and Telematics
GPS trackers, temperature monitors, and shock sensors embedded in packages transmit live telemetry throughout transit. This granular visibility helps mitigate risks for sensitive cargo—automatically triggering alerts on deviations and simplifying insurance claims through precise incident logs. - Blockchain for Supply-Chain Transparency
Distributed ledger technology creates tamper-proof records of each shipment event—pickup, customs clearance, transfer, and delivery. Stakeholders across the network can verify provenance and audit trails, reducing disputes and building trust in cross-border transactions. - Warehouse Robotics and Automation
Autonomous guided vehicles (AGVs), robotic pick-and-pack cells, and vision-guided sorting systems streamline fulfillment centers. By reducing human error and speeding throughput, these technologies ensure parcels are accurately routed and consolidated for optimal transport. - Autonomous Last-Mile Delivery
In select markets, drones, sidewalk robots, and electric autonomous vans are being piloted for final-mile delivery. These solutions expand delivery windows, cut carbon emissions, and bypass urban congestion—offering rapid, flexible options for high-priority shipments. - Data Analytics and Customer Insights
Dashboards aggregating KPIs—transit times, exception rates, and delivery success—provide actionable insights. Shippers use these analytics to fine-tune copyright selection, negotiate contracts, and proactively communicate with customers about delivery expectations.
As 5G connectivity, digital twins, and quantum computing mature, the pace of innovation in international parcel shipping will only accelerate—empowering businesses to deliver faster, greener, and more predictable cross-border experiences.
